Caption

Public Service Commission - Net Energy Metering - Successor Program

Impact

The introduction of SB966 has significant implications for state energy laws and the renewables sector. If passed, the bill would amend existing statutes and potentially replace the outdated net energy metering framework with a more sustainable and equitable version. It would establish conditions for the program's continuation until a combined generating capacity reaches a designated threshold. Furthermore, the bill emphasizes the importance of equity in energy distribution and cost-sharing among different energy users, which could reshape how energy costs are approached in the state.

Summary

Senate Bill 966 seeks to modernize Maryland's net energy metering framework by requiring the Public Service Commission to develop a successor program to replace the current net energy metering program. The bill aims to foster the growth of distributed generation by incentivizing new energy sources while ensuring that ratepayer costs are minimized. The target is to create a program that provides fair compensation for energy exports and adequately addresses the needs of the electric grid. This legislation is part of a larger push towards promoting renewable energy and distributed generation in the state.

Contention

There is notable contention surrounding the bill, particularly regarding its impact on existing energy policies and stakeholder interests. Proponents argue that it enhances opportunities for renewable energy development and provides necessary updates for a transitioning energy landscape. However, critics raise concerns about potential backlash from utility companies and existing customers who may face changes to their current arrangements. The balance between facilitating renewable energy growth and maintaining fairness for all electricity users presents a challenge that will likely be at the forefront of discussions as the bill progresses.
